Yes - the salt-laden marine air in Oxnard accelerates rust on standard hardware and breaks down wood sealants faster than inland climates. Choosing stainless steel fasteners and composite or treated wood for coastal exposure directly extends the life of your deck.
In California, a permit is required for any deck attached to your home or elevated more than 30 inches off the ground. The permit process includes plan review and at least one inspection. The California Department of Housing and Community Development oversees statewide building standards that all local departments follow.
Composite decking consistently outperforms wood in coastal climates. It resists moisture, UV fading, and salt air damage without annual sealing. Wood decks cost less upfront but require more consistent maintenance to avoid deterioration in Oxnard's marine environment.
Cosmetic issues like fading or minor scratches are repair candidates. Soft boards, a bouncy feel underfoot, wobbling railings, or visible rot at the framing level are signs the structure itself is failing. Once rot reaches the posts or beams, full replacement is usually more cost-effective than patching.
Boards that lie flat and even with consistent gaps, railings that do not move when you push on them, and stairs that feel solid underfoot. No visible rust stains, raised fasteners, or soft spots. If soft spots or rot have reached the structural framing, full replacement is usually more cost-effective. Boards and railings can often be repaired, but failed footings or rotted beams require a rebuild. A contractor assessment tells you which situation you are in before you spend money on the wrong fix.
Budget, maintenance tolerance, and proximity to the coast all factor in. Composite decking is the low-maintenance option that performs well in salt air. Wood decks cost less upfront but need regular care. The American Wood Protection Association publishes treatment standards for wood used in outdoor structures.
The California Contractors State License Board website lets you search any contractor's license number in about two minutes. You can confirm whether the license is active, what work it covers, and whether any complaints are on file. Always verify before signing a contract - and ask whether the contractor pulls permits themselves.

Oxnard is the largest city in Ventura County, with a population of over 200,000 and a housing stock that largely reflects rapid residential growth between the 1950s and 1990s. The city sits directly on the Pacific coast, bordered by the Channel Islands Harbor to the southwest and the Oxnard Plain agricultural corridor to the east. Neighborhoods range from beachfront homes along Hollywood Beach and Silver Strand Beach to newer master-planned communities like Riverpark and established neighborhoods in Colonia and Oxnard Shores.
The coastal location that makes Oxnard one of the most desirable places to live in Southern California also creates real challenges for outdoor structures. Salt-laden marine air rolls in from the Channel Islands year-round, and homes along Hollywood Beach, Silver Strand, and the harbor face accelerated wear on wood, metal hardware, and exterior finishes. The Oxnard Plain also sits on alluvial soil deposited by the Santa Clara River, which can be sandy near the coast and more clay-like farther inland - a condition that affects how deck footings need to be designed and set in different neighborhoods.
